Lil Flip Blasts Sony Records, Speaks on New Album

    Lil’ Flip’s been targeted by many.
    First, critics slammed him for lines like “I treat you like milk. I’ll
    do nothing but spoil you.”
    Then Tip got out of
    prison and went to war with The Leprechaun. But along the way,
    Flipper
    found time to make a new album. 

    The LP was close to seeing the light of day when moreobstacles
    were thrown in Flip’s direction. Recently, he spoke out, stating
    that his former label, Sony betrayed him. This
    caused the Houston
    representative to make a jump to Asylum Records.

    So, what lead to the jump? According to him, it seems Sony
    was responsible for his album leaking.

    “All I know is my copy is watermarked, I didn’t
    leak it and the only other people that have it is
    Sony…The
    point of taking the masters was so we could release the album exactly how it
    was. Now we have to regroup,”
    he said to Billboard about his
    ex-label.

    Flip went on to state that he feels he was
    never fully backed by the label.

    “Everybody wanted to sign me and I had fans…With
    that type of ammunition,
    Sony was able to take
    me to platinum with barely any promotion. I had two videos and went over
    platinum. Most rappers need three to four videos to go platinum. Imagine if
    someone was really behind me. At this point in my career I can’t settle for
    part of a promotional campaign, and Sony would not give me 100%.”

    The deals are not over. Flip
    is also in talks to put on his Clover G label.
    For now, his focus is on regrouping, and prepping I Need Mine for a
    2007 release.
